适用于条斑紫菜的双向电泳样品制备方法

摘要:
为了建立适于条斑紫菜(Porphyra yezoensis)蛋白质组学分析的的样品提取方法, 作者以条斑紫菜叶状体为材料, 比较了饱和硫酸铵沉淀法、三氯乙酸/丙酮沉淀法和酚提取方法3 种方法对条斑紫菜叶状体总蛋白的提取效果。结果表明, 针对条斑紫菜叶状体细胞中含有大量多糖, 多酚化合物, 色素等干扰物质的特点, 通过酚提取方法能有效去除这些干扰杂质, 得到清晰、稳定、干净的双向电泳图谱和相对较多的蛋白质点数, 为提高其他大型海藻的总可溶性蛋白提取效率提供了重要参考。

A protein extraction method suitable for two-dimensional electrophoresis analysis of Porphyra yezoensis
Abstract:
Three different methods including saturated ammonium sulfate precipitation, trichloroacetic acid/acetone precipitation (TCA) and phenol extraction (Phe) have been compared to determine their efficiency in extracting total proteins from thalli of Porphyra yezoensis by two-dimensional electrophoresis (2-DE) analysis. The results showed that phenol protein extraction method gave the distinct stable and clear 2-DE map and was capable of generating more protein spots under the situation that there are many interfering substances of salinity, polysaccharide and pigments in the cells of P. yezoensis thalli. Findings from this study are of great significance for developing effective protein extraction methods for other macroalgae.
